Address 0 PPC

PDNknAwDMzstPT676a7gxN5PfvAU2uKS2W

Confirmed

Total Received25.355699 PPC
Total Sent25.355699 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DNknAwDMzstPT676a7gxN5PfvAU2uKS2W25.355699 PPC
Fee: 0.01 PPC
626846 Confirmations25.345699 PPC
PDNknAwDMzstPT676a7gxN5PfvAU2uKS2W25.355699 PPC
PQ2ZJoyqKi856GeX2q4xHzSm9M6LfoR7jc2.049769 PPC
Fee: 0.01 PPC
626854 Confirmations27.405468 PPC